About Workato

Workato is the leading Control and Execution Platform for Enterprise AI — the neutral platform enterprises trust to put AI to work across their business. Workato unifies data, applications, and processes into a single platform so AI can reliably orchestrate business processes in production at enterprise scale. Built on more than a decade of running mission-critical processes for over half the Fortune 500 — including Nasdaq, Amazon, Cisco, Vodafone, Atlassian, and Lucid Motors — Workato turns over 14,000 enterprise systems AI needs to act on into one governed execution layer. Responsibilities

We are growing our Enterprise CS team and looking to add an exceptional Senior Enterprise Customer Success Manager. In this role, you will work with our Enterprise customers and ensure their success via the rapid adoption of the Workato Intelligent Automation Platform. As an Enterprise Customer Success Manager, you will play an integral role in our business as a trusted customer advisor and serve as the customer advocate liaison between customers and internal teams, including Sales, Solution Consulting, Professional Services, Product, and Marketing, among others.

In this role, you will also be responsible to:

  • Own a portfolio of assigned accounts that may vary in market size, industry, and complexity, with a focus on ensuring value realization through the use of the Workato platform, increasing adoption across a variety of business and functional units, ensuring retention and supporting growth. Deliver on ambitious NRR targets
  • Develop a strong command of Workato’s unique value propositions, the business value our key capabilities drive, our approach to Enterprise Automation, our customer use cases/success stories, and our best practices. Leverage the aforementioned knowledge and your technical Workato product expertise to guide the customer on their Enterprise Automation journey.
  • Develop and maintain strategic business relationships with enterprise customers to drive adoption, assess and evangelize value received, and assist in revenue expansion. Establish regular touchpoints with the assigned customers per established practices to review progress against strategic business and technical product objectives
  • Develop and maintain engagement with senior customer executives to understand their strategic objectives and position Workato for their transformation initiatives, including delivering Customer Objectives reviews, Executive Business reviews, etc. Run workshops , hackathons, trainings etc to increase usage of the product
  • Develop a deep understanding of a customer's business, use cases, and desired outcomes to guide them to achieve these via Workato’s product and services. Develop and drive programs to increase usage of the product within the current (landed) group and expand usage to other business groups/functions
  • Create customer assets, including a Joint Success Plan, to be leveraged by our sponsors, outlining progress with Workato mapped to their business initiatives, value, deployment plans, etc.
  • Monitor customers' achievement of desired outcomes and value, consistently and effectively telling the story of these both to internal stakeholders and externally to key customer stakeholders
  • Be the expert in deployment models and governance structures and share best practices from a business and technical perspective
  • Serve as the primary point of escalation when customer issues arise and effectively prioritize/orchestrate resolution of customer requests or issues
  • Develop trusted and collaborative relationships with internal stakeholders and business partners; and champion customers internally to mitigate risk, improve customer experience, drive to value outcomes, and unlock growth
  • Professionally manage your book of business and provide periodic and accurate reporting, develop growth and risk mitigation plans, following our playbooks, best practices, and documentation requirement
  • Contribute to the development of Customer Success practice, develop playbooks, and drive process innovation and operational efficiency

What you need to know about the Sydney Tech Scene

From opera to comedy shows, the Sydney Opera House hosts more than 1,600 performances a year, yet its entertainment sector isn't the only one taking center stage. The city's tech sector has earned a reputation as one of the fastest-growing in the region. More specifically, its IT sector stands out as the country's third-largest, growing at twice the rate of overall employment in the past decade as businesses continue to digitize their operations to stay competitive.
